Metal Shavings
 
Those of you that have changed and inspected your fuel filters, did you find metal shavings? After reading some other forums besides this one it seems to happening to at least a few trucks. Just wondering how common this really is and if it's a precursor to the hpfp failure. Mine have not been changed yet but will be soon. I think Epic found nothing in his but how about others. I had some small metal shavings that looked almost identical the one of the threads here. I did take it in to the dealer and Ford directed the dealer to do nothing. I found out later that this dealer has seen a few others and they believe it is likely trash from filling up.
